Full Plot Details

Inspired by true events. On an isolated stretch of land fifty miles outside of San Francisco sits the most haunted house in the world. Built by Sarah Winchester (Dame Helen Mirren) heiress to the Winchester fortune, it is a house that knows no end. Constructed in an incessant twenty-four hour a day, seven day a week mania for decades, it stands seven stories tall and contains hundreds of rooms. To an outsider it looks like a monstrous monument to a disturbed woman's madness. But Sarah is not building for herself, for her niece Marion (Sarah Snook), nor for the brilliant Dr. Eric Price (Jason Clarke), who she has summoned to the house. She is building a prison, an asylum for hundreds of vengeful ghosts, and the most terrifying amongst them have a score to settle with the Winchesters.
